Kurt is one of many Managing Partners of Sun Contracting, a construction company that began in the early in the 90's. Kurt is also the President of Taco Mayo, which is a chain of contemporary Tex-Mex restaurants ones own across the south central region of the US. He and Randy Earhart, the other Managing Pojkv?n, began Sun Construction to accommodate the needs of their burgeoning restaurant business. With 88+ restaurants spread all around the south central US since 1978, in-house construction and remodeling of many of these became a necessity. The person found that they could manage the construction more economically and efficiently if they acted as the general contractors. By using successful business model implemented, other people were soon requesting their services.

The 2007 Showcase home set a fundraising record. Over 70 vendors, engineers, craftspeople and artisans donated or heavily discounted their materials that went into the three bedroom, one outdoor living room space house. "Normally, it would take at least a year to build this kind of home, rather than little more than four months, " Dinnes said. "The subcontractors went way beyond the call to duty, " he said. All this in order to meet the Showcase of Homes deadline. The 3, 500-Square-foot house includes a 700 square-foot game-theater room. "This is the room of rooms, very well Dinnes said. The house also has many smaller elements that make a house a home, together with a pot-filler faucet by the stove and six showerheads in the master shower. Dinnes said "the more sophisticated new owner will inquire about updated options for the bathroom, but he also likes educating other buyers about their shower alternatives. I love building people's dream homes, " he said.

The profits from the house big event sale went to The Southwest Homes charity. This charity donates money to the local school districts, YMCA, and houses for disabled children that they support. The Showcase Home was featured in Central SO Homes Magazine and drew over 2500 visitors. People from the area came to not only see the home and even to view the latest technology in the home building industry. The Showcase Home featured chiseled stone, début cedar beams, scribed wood floors, high-tech appliances, low VOC lighting, house-wide surround sound, a grill theater system, and an outdoor living room complete with fireplace.
